      How well do YOU know snakes? Snakes live among us, as they always have. We think we know them, but snakes have many astonishing secrets, all revealed in this snake book for kids.What is the world's most dangerous snake? What snake mother twitches to warm her eggs until they hatch? What is the only snake in the world that builds a nest for her eggs? Where in the world could you see the largest snake gathering - and why are all those thousands of snakes there? What two island nations and two American states have no native snakes, and why? Snakes don't smell things with their noses, yet they have an excellent sense of smell. How do they do it? Where would you go to eat a snake dinner? What ancient snake attacked and ate dinosaurs? With more than 300 intriguing facts and 50+ color photos, Fun Snake Facts for Kids is the 11th book in the series Fun Animal Facts for Kids from Crimson Hill Books. For ages 7 to 12 or Grades 3 to 5. About the Author Jacquelyn Johnson writes books for curious and creative kids ages 8 to 12. This includes the lively Fun Animal Facts for Kids Series about animals, pets and the natural world. She also writes the Morley Stories Series of novels for girls 10 to 13. Jacquelyn is also a former teacher, college and university lecturer. She has taught English as a Second Language to children and teenagers in South Korea and journalism to university students in South Dakota and Ontario....
